To perform the multiplication \( 25.7 \times 0.78 \times 2.3 \), we'll calculate the answer step by step and determine the significant figures in the final result.

Step 1: Calculate using a calculator

  1. Calculate \( 25.7 \times 0.78 \): \[ 25.7 \times 0.78 = 20.046 \]

  2. Multiply the result by \( 2.3 \): \[ 20.046 \times 2.3 = 46.1058 \]

Step 2: Identify significant figures

Now, we will identify the number of significant figures in each of the original numbers:

  • 25.7: 3 significant figures (the digits 2, 5, and 7)
  • 0.78: 2 significant figures (the digits 7 and 8)
  • 2.3: 2 significant figures (the digits 2 and 3)

Step 3: Determine the limiting factor

When multiplying numbers, the result should have the same number of significant figures as the number with the fewest significant figures.

  • \( 25.7 \) has 3 significant figures
  • \( 0.78 \) has 2 significant figures (limiting factor)
  • \( 2.3 \) has 2 significant figures

Thus, our final result will be limited to 2 significant figures.

Step 4: Round the answer

The calculator answer from our multiplication was 46.1058. To round this to 2 significant figures:

  1. Look at the first two digits (46).
  2. The next digit (1) indicates we do not need to round up.

Thus, rounding \( 46.1058 \) to 2 significant figures gives us 46.

Final Summary:

  • Calculator answer: \( 46.1058 \)
  • Significant digits answer: \( 46 \)
  • Number of significant digits: 2

So the final answer is 46 with 2 significant figures.
